A pair of two-way power dividers/combiners from Krytar provides continuous frequency coverage from 3 to 4 GHz. Available as model 6020400 with 2.4-mm female connectors or as model 6020400K with 2.92-mm female connectors, the power dividers/combiners minimize insertion loss to 2 dB or less over the full frequency range, with better than 14 dB isolation between ports. The maximum VSWR is 1.95:P1. The amplitude tracking is +/-0.5 dB while the phase tracking is +/-7 deg. The coaxial power dividers/combiners weigh only 1.1 oz.
